What Is React JS Development?

Developed by Facebook engineer Jordan Walke, React JS is a JavaScript library designed to help developers create UIs for web applications. It is designed to be easy to use and can be easily deployed by anyone with a basic knowledge of JavaScript. React is a popular choice for developing innovative websites and mobile apps.

React provides state of the art functionality, including fast page rendering. In addition, the framework is highly productive. It uses the Virtual DOM to monitor component state and find the least expensive way to update the DOM. It also provides built-in hooks that allow developers to update default browser actions without reloading the entire page.

React JS uses the JSX extension of JavaScript, which embeds HTML functionality directly into JavaScript code. This allows developers to build high-volume applications that combine HTML markup with JavaScript logic. It also allows developers to write custom components.

The React JS framework also uses the SyntheticEvent wrapper to replace the native Event interface. The wrapper allows developers to build a better, more flexible event-driven UI.

There are many benefits to using React JS, including a smaller library size. It also allows developers to use JavaScript to build user interfaces for most platforms. It’s also easy to test your code. You can even communicate with the server in record time with React.

You can build complex UI interactions with React JS. You can do this using hooks, which are a modern way to handle state. The key to using hooks effectively is to call the top-level event rather than sub-events.

Leave a comment